    • @hipsukun
      @hipsukun 7 лет назад +2

      A late reply, but the speed of spreading IS considerably slower than how you played. A flame doesn't create new flames, only blazes do that (but not on the same turn they themselves were created).
      You seemed to play correctly until 1:07:35 where flames start creating flames. :)
      That said, I personally like the kindling rule and am always sad when it's NA...
